We monitor options market activity to understand when markets might be too bullish or bearish. 51Talk Online Education Group American depositary shares each representing 60 (COE) experienced a notable decline recently, with shares falling approximately 9.23% to trade around $23.60 per share. This downward move has brought the stock to an important technical juncture, testing support near $22.42 while facing resistance at $24.78.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, COE has descended toward a support zone near $22.42 following the recent decline. This level represents a potential area where buying interest could emerge, though the breach of this support would open the door to further downside testing. The proximity of the current price to this support zone suggests traders should monitor price behavior closely in the coming sessions. Resistance has established itself in the $24.78 area, creating a meaningful ceiling that the stock must overcome to establish a more constructive technical posture. Until COE can reclaim territory above this level, the path of least resistance may remain tilted toward the downside. The gap between current trading levels and this resistance zone underscores the corrective nature of the recent price action.
